Maze Earns Third SoCon Player Of The Week Honor This Season

SPARTANBURG, S.C. – For the third time this season, Samford senior center fielder Shelby Maze was named the Southern Conference's Player of the Week when the league released its weekly softball awards Monday afternoon.
 
Maze previously earned the honor on March 5 and April 2. Her three honors are tied for the most of any SoCon player this season.
 
In three games last week, Maze hit .778 (7-for-9) with three RBI and four runs scored in leading Samford to a series win over Western Carolina. During the series, she became Samford's all-time career leader in hits with 280, eclipsing the previous record of 274, set by current Samford assistant coach Megan Dowdy (2013-16).
 
Maze went 2-for-2 with an RBI in game one of the series. In the second game, she was 2-for-3 with an RBI, and she went 3-for-4 with an RBI and three runs scored in the series finale.
 
For the season, Maze is hitting a team-best .417 with three doubles, a triple, nine RBI and a team-high 29 runs scored. Maze enters this week on an 11-game hit streak, and she has a team-best 16 multi-hit games so far this season.
